How to Style Your Summer Dress Now
Ready to make the most out of your summer dress collection? Use these clever styling tips to refresh your looks and ensure each dress works for multiple occasions.
1. Layer Smartly for Unpredictable Weather
- Light Jackets: Drape a cropped denim or utility jacket over your shoulders for chilly mornings or evenings.
- Blazers: A tailored, monochrome blazer instantly elevates a casual dress for workplace chic or evening drinks.
- Knotted Shirts: Tie a crisp white button-down at the waist over a slip dress for added visual interest and coverage.
2. Master Monochrome and Tonal Looks
- Choose a single color palette for a luxury-inspired vibe.
- Pair butter yellow dresses with tan accessories for a natural, sun-kissed aesthetic.
- Mix different textures within the same shade for added depth (e.g., jersey blues with suede sandals).
3. Accessories That Transform
- Shoes: Rotate between ballet flats, kitten heels, sporty trainers, or gladiator sandals to match the occasion.
- Bags: Opt for structured handbags, woven totes, or mini crossbody purses that stay practical and chic.
- Jewelry: Statement earrings, delicate layered necklaces, and stackable bracelets bring personality, especially if the dress print is simple.
- Belts: Cinch flowy dresses at the waist with a bold or braided belt for a flattering silhouette.
4. Go Retro with Bold Statements
- Try bubble-hem minis with chunky sneakers and oversized scrunchies for ’80s-inspired fun.
- Mix polka dot maxis with red lipstick and vintage sunglasses for a playful nod to old Hollywood.
- Add a wide-brim hat, especially with boho maxis, to channel effortless festival glamour.
5. Suitcase Essentials: Dresses for Travel
- Pack a cotton midi—breathable and perfect for sightseeing with Birkenstocks, yet dressy enough for dinner with kitten heels.
- Slip dresses are ideal for layering and rolling small; take several bright prints and rotate for different looks.
- Look for dresses with pockets—functional and stylish for busy days out.
Style Inspiration: Day-to-Night Looks
Maximize your dress collection by styling each piece for varying occasions throughout the day.
Occasion | Suggested Dress Style | Key Accessories | Styling Tip |
---|---|---|---|
Daytime Brunch | Floral midi or gingham apron dress | Espadrilles, woven bag, layered gold necklaces | Add a straw hat for extra shade and style |
Beach/Resort | Slip dress or flowy maxi | Slides, oversized sunnies, lightweight scarf | Use scarf as cover-up; skip heavy jewelry |
Work Event | Structured blazer over monochrome midi | Knee-length boots, classic tote, silver hoops | Keep prints subtle; opt for sleek hair |
Night Out | Bubble hem mini or polka dot strapless | Block heels, clutch, statement earrings | Add bold lipstick for instant glam |

Smart Shopping: How to Choose the Right Summer Dress
- Consider Fabric: Prioritize natural fibers (cotton, linen, silk blends) for breathability.
- Fit Matters: Go for shapes that highlight your favorite features—A-line for comfort, wrap styles for versatility.
- Budget Wisely: A few quality pieces will serve you more than many fast-fashion buys. Invest in staples, play with accessories for variety.
- Check Pockets and Practicality: Dresses with pockets add function; check lining and closures for durability.
- Try On Trends: Experiment with new colors and shapes in affordable pieces before investing; statement prints, bubble hems, and bold palettes are easy upgrades.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: Can summer dresses work outside warm seasons?
A: Yes! Layer with tights, chunky knits, and boots or add a long-sleeve top underneath to transition many summer dresses into fall and spring.
Q: What accessories elevate a simple summer dress?
A: Statement jewelry, a structured blazer, a designer-inspired bag, and a chic pair of shoes can instantly add flair and polish.
Q: Are bold prints still on trend?
A: Absolutely. Polka dots, stripes, gingham, and bright florals are summer staples and are continually refreshed by leading designers.
Q: How can I keep summer dress looks budget-friendly?
A: Invest in versatile base dresses and focus your spending on accessories—mixing and matching keeps outfits fresh without overspending.
Q: What footwear best suits summer dresses this year?
A: Ballet flats, sporty trainers, classic espadrilles, and kitten heels are all in style—switch up based on your dress style and activity.
